The dill flavor just brightens the dip up, the garlic adds a nice little punch of flavor, and the ricotta is so creamy and rich. Serve this with crostini or dip in some fresh veggies. It’s even good tossed on some plain pasta for an easy dinner recipe!

Directions:

In a medium bowl, combine the cheese and dill. Squeeze the entire head of garlic into the mixture. Add one teaspoon of olive oil and the salt. Stir well to combine.

Place in a serving bowl and drizzle with the remaining teaspoon of olive oil.

Serve spread on crostini or as a dip for vegetables, chips, or crackers.
